The Shelfwright batch importer now validates MARC-style records before committing them to the Lanternfield Library catalogue. Previously, malformed subject headings could halt an entire import and leave partial records visible to patrons. Imports are now transactional: a failed batch rolls back cleanly and writes a diagnostic report to the import dashboard. Support should direct any reports of duplicate titles from pre-2.14.3 imports to the dedup utility. All escalations for this change go to the engineer named below.

named custodian: Belius Casath Ulaix Sorius

- Reception has moved to the ground floor of Kestrel Yard — ignore signs pointing to Level 2.
- Report there by 09:00 on day one; bring photo ID.
- Collect your welcome pack and locker key.
- The staff entrance beside reception needs a pass code until your badge is printed; use the one below.

staff pass of kawip-hawef = bdg-QLP-2

**Mgmt Meeting Minutes — Retiring the Brightline Range**

Quick recap for sales leads at Fenholt Supplies: we agreed to retire the Brightline fixture range by year-end. Remaining stock moves to clearance pricing next month, and accounts on standing orders get migrated to the Lumetta range. Trade-in incentives were approved in principle. The confidential note on next steps sits just below.

board note of bajof-bajeg: The pricing group signed off on a budget of $13.4 million for Project Sildor. The renewal with Lamixek Holdings closes at $48.9 million a year, 49 percent above the last contract.

When a content edit lands in Thornvale, the rebuild scheduler computes the affected page set from the fragment graph and enqueues only those pages. If the affected set exceeds a threshold, we fall back to a full rebuild since per-page overhead dominates. On-call should know that a stuck queue usually means the graph snapshot is stale; restarting the indexer clears it. Timeouts and batch sizes were tuned on the Harwick staging cluster over two weeks. Current values are listed below.

constants for fafof-yadug:
QUOTAS = {
    "gorael": 575,
    "kasok": 31,
}